Siddipet: The district collector P Venkatrami Reddy has instructed the officials of the district administration to set up a control room at Collectorate and Revenue Divisional Offices to attend to people’s calls. Assessing the situation after rains lashed Siddipet district on Tuesday and Wednesday, the Collector said that the IMD is forecast heavy rains in the State for next three days.

As a culvert swept away near Anna Sagar village of Mulug Mandal due to rains last night, the Collector has inspected the place to examine the situation. Speaking on the occasion, Reddy has directed the officials to take all the necessary care to avoid any human or property loss due to rains during the next few days.


He has instructed the engineering department officials to visit all the low-lying areas and causeways to examine the situation. The Collector has suggested them to shift the people who were residing in low-lying areas if the situation demands. Reddy has said that the engineering department officials must take all the responsibilities. He has also called upon the people to take all the due care whenever they comes out since all the streams and water bodies were overflowing like never before.
